Trident Seafoods is North America's largest vertically integrated seafood harvesting and processing company. Trident is a privately held, 100 percent USA-owned company with global operations in 6 countries and serves customers in almost 60 countries. Headquartered in Seattle, Washington (USA), Trident employs approximately 7,700 people worldwide each year and partners with over 2,700 independent fishermen and crewmembers in Alaska. Trident catches and processes virtually every commercial species of salmon, whitefish, and crab harvested in the North Pacific and Alaska. The global supply chain also encompasses cultured and wild species sourced from an international network of trusted suppliers.

Summary: The Accounts Payable Specialist - Payments & Vendor Management is responsible for ensuring timely, accurate, and compliant vendor payments while maintaining strong vendor relationships and accurate vendor master data. This position serves as a key contact for vendors and internal stakeholders, resolving payment issues, supporting vendor-onboarding and maintaining adherence to internal controls and company policies.

The ideal candidate is customer-focused, detail-oriented, analytical, and committed to continuous improvement within the procure-to-pay process.

Essential Functions:

  • Execute scheduled payment runs, including ACH, wire, check, and virtual card payments.
  • Review payment proposals for accuracy, completeness, and proper approvals.
  • Investigate and resolve payment exceptions, holds, and rejected transactions.
  • Ensure compliance with company payment policies, delegation of authority, and internal controls.
  • Support 1099 reporting activities and year-end vendor payment compliance requirements.
  • Assist with corporate card and employee expense reimbursement processes, as assigned.
  • Serve as the primary contact for vendor payment inquiries and issue resolution.
  • Maintain accurate vendor master records, including vendor setup, changes, banking information, and deactivations as assigned
  • Validate vendor documentation including W-9s, W-8s, banking information, insurance certificates, and other required compliance documents as assigned
  • Partner with leadership to ensure vendor compliance requirements are met.
  • Conduct periodic reviews of vendor records to ensure data accuracy and minimize fraud risks.
  • Support vendor onboarding activities and ensure all required approvals and documentation are obtained prior to activation.
  • Identify opportunities to improve payment processing efficiency and vendor experience.
  • Regularly works onsite to build strong team connections, collaborate across functions, and solve problems in real time.
